{"product_id":"rust-asynchronous-programming-a-comprehensive-guide-to-concurrency-parallelism-for-building-high-performance-and-scalable-systems-9798288956157","title":"Rust Asynchronous Programming: A Comprehensive Guide to Concurrency \u0026 Parallelism for Building High-performance and Scalable Systems","description":"\u003cp\u003e • Author(s): Thomas M. Noble\u003cbr\u003e • Publisher: Independently Published\u003cbr\u003e • Publisher Imprint: Independently Published\u003cbr\u003e • BISAC: Programming - Parallel\u003c\/p\u003e\u003cp\u003e\u003c\/p\u003e\u003cp\u003e\u003ci\u003e\u003cb\u003eStop fighting concurrency and start mastering it. This is your definitive guide to architecting high-performance, resilient, and scalable systems with asynchronous Rust.\u003c\/b\u003e\u003c\/i\u003e\u003c\/p\u003e\u003cp\u003eHave you ever built an application that works perfectly with ten users, only to see it crumble under the load of a thousand? The gap between simple programs and truly scalable systems can seem immense, a black box of concepts like \u003ci\u003eFutures\u003c\/i\u003e, \u003ci\u003eExecutors\u003c\/i\u003e, and \u003ci\u003ework-stealing\u003c\/i\u003e. You know your service needs to be faster and more robust, but the path to getting there is unclear.\u003c\/p\u003e\u003cp\u003e\u003cbr\u003eThis book is the bridge across that gap. It is engineered to transform you, an intermediate Rust programmer, into an expert capable of building production-grade asynchronous systems. It goes beyond the syntax to demystify the \"magic\" of the async runtime, giving you a deep, foundational understanding of how to build services that don't just survive the load-they thrive on it. Asynchronous Rust is a revolutionary approach to handling massive I\/O workloads with minimal overhead, all while leveraging Rust's legendary compile-time safety to eliminate entire classes of concurrency bugs before they happen.\u003c\/p\u003e\u003cp\u003e\u003cb\u003eWHAT'S INSIDE: \u003c\/b\u003e\u003c\/p\u003e\u003cp\u003eThis book is a direct, hands-on guide that systematically builds your expertise. You will not just learn the patterns; you will build them, test them, and understand them from first principles. Inside, you will master: \u003c\/p\u003e\u003cul\u003e\n\u003cli\u003e\n\u003cb\u003e\u003ci\u003eAsync Foundations: \u003c\/i\u003e\u003c\/b\u003e Go under the hood to see how async\/await compiles into hyper-efficient state machines, and why Pin is the key to its memory safety.\u003c\/li\u003e\n\u003cli\u003e\n\u003cb\u003e\u003ci\u003eThe Tokio Runtime: \u003c\/i\u003e\u003c\/b\u003e Learn to expertly manage tasks with the de facto standard async runtime, and understand the work-stealing scheduler that makes it so powerful.\u003c\/li\u003e\n\u003cli\u003e\n\u003cb\u003e\u003ci\u003eAdvanced Control Flow: \u003c\/i\u003e\u003c\/b\u003e Wield the tokio:: select! macro to race multiple operations, build resilient timeouts, and implement clean, server-wide graceful shutdown.\u003c\/li\u003e\n\u003cli\u003e\n\u003cb\u003e\u003ci\u003eConcurrent State \u0026amp; Communication: \u003c\/i\u003e\u003c\/b\u003e Master the two core patterns for inter-task communication.\u003c\/li\u003e\n\u003cli\u003e\n\u003cb\u003e\u003ci\u003eData Processing with Streams: \u003c\/i\u003e\u003c\/b\u003e Tame asynchronous sequences of events using the Stream trait and its powerful combinators to build declarative data pipelines.\u003c\/li\u003e\n\u003cli\u003e\n\u003cb\u003e\u003ci\u003eThe Async\/Parallel Bridge: \u003c\/i\u003e\u003c\/b\u003e Learn the definitive pattern for combining Tokio's I\/O concurrency with rayon's CPU parallelism using spawn_blocking, creating applications with ultimate performance.\u003c\/li\u003e\n\u003cli\u003e\n\u003cb\u003e\u003ci\u003eProduction-Grade Engineering: \u003c\/i\u003e\u003c\/b\u003e Harden your services with essential guides on testing, security, diagnostics with tokio-console, and building APIs with the axum and tonic frameworks.\u003c\/li\u003e\n\u003cli\u003e\n\u003cb\u003e\u003ci\u003eCapstone Project: \u003c\/i\u003e\u003c\/b\u003e Synthesize every skill by building a high-performance, persistent, in-memory key-value store and pub\/sub server from scratch.\u003c\/li\u003e\n\u003c\/ul\u003e\u003cp\u003e\u003cbr\u003e\u003cb\u003eWHO THIS BOOK IS FOR: \u003c\/b\u003e\u003c\/p\u003e\u003cp\u003eThis book is for the \u003cb\u003eintermediate Rust programmer\u003c\/b\u003e who is ready to level up. If you're comfortable with Rust's fundamentals and want to build the fast, scalable, and resilient network services that power modern infrastructure, this guide is your next step.\u003c\/p\u003e\u003cp\u003e\u003ci\u003eIt's time to make concurrency your greatest strength.\u003c\/i\u003e\u003c\/p\u003e\u003cp\u003e\u003cb\u003eDon't just \u003c\/b\u003e\u003cb\u003e\u003ci\u003euse\u003c\/i\u003e\u003c\/b\u003e\u003cb\u003e \u003c\/b\u003e\u003cb\u003easync\u003c\/b\u003e\u003cb\u003e Rust. Master it. Start building the next generation of high-performance systems today.\u003c\/b\u003e\u003c\/p\u003e","brand":"Atlantic Books","offers":[{"title":"Paperback","offer_id":46335139709079,"sku":"9798288956157","price":2045.0,"currency_code":"INR","in_stock":true}],"thumbnail_url":"\/\/cdn.shopify.com\/s\/files\/1\/0666\/3471\/1191\/files\/9798288956157.webp?v=1768674126","url":"https:\/\/atlanticbooks.com\/products\/rust-asynchronous-programming-a-comprehensive-guide-to-concurrency-parallelism-for-building-high-performance-and-scalable-systems-9798288956157","provider":"Atlantic Books","version":"1.0","type":"link"}